Choosing Your Compound Bow

11412131_10204351405410452_2328858177141704241_n

 

 

Mathews, Hoyt, Bowtech, Bear…so many brands…so many styles! Just how is a girl to decide? Well, ladies, there is just one rule to follow when it comes to picking out your bow!! And that rule is:

Try It Before You Buy It!!!!!

There is so much more to picking out the right bow than just taking someone’s advice or picking one that you like the looks of! You will be the one shooting the bow, so you need to try it out before you buy it!!! I remember picking out my bow, and I sure didn’t end up with the one I had planned on.

I had been looking at bows for a while and there were several that I was interested in. I had even come close to buying one without trying any out. Luckily my husband and I attended a deer and turkey expo where there were numerous vendors set up to sell bows. I was able to get an up close look at many different brands and styles. Even better, Shoot Like A Girl was on hand with a wide variety of bows available for trying out. I immediately went to the bow that looked the best to me, but I was quickly disappointed. So, next I went to the brand I was thinking about buying, but also found I didn’t care much for the bows I tried. So I just continued on to try out every bow they had. I kept going back to one particular bow over and over. I compared every other bow I picked up to this particular bow. It wasn’t the prettiest, in fact, it wasn’t even a bow designed for women. But, it was the one that fit me the best; it just felt right! I am so glad that I took the time to test out a lot of the different options, and I recommend that you do the same thing!! I guess it’s kind of like picking out your wedding dress; when you find the right one, you just know!
